peta jaringan. Gambaran singkat perangkat lunak untuk membangun peta jaringan

peta jaringan. Gambaran singkat perangkat lunak untuk membangun peta jaringan

0. Pendahuluan, atau sedikit di luar topikArtikel ini lahir hanya karena sangat sulit untuk menemukan karakteristik komparatif dari perangkat lunak tersebut, atau bahkan hanya sebuah daftar, di satu tempat. Kami harus menyekop banyak bahan untuk sampai pada setidaknya semacam kesimpulan.

Dalam hal ini, saya memutuskan untuk menghemat sedikit waktu dan tenaga bagi mereka yang tertarik dengan masalah ini, dan mengumpulkan di satu tempat sebanyak mungkin, baca yang saya kuasai, jumlah sistem untuk pemetaan jaringan di satu tempat.

Beberapa sistem yang dijelaskan dalam artikel ini telah saya coba sendiri. Kemungkinan besar, ini tidak relevan pada versi saat ini. Saya melihat beberapa hal berikut untuk pertama kalinya, dan informasi tentangnya dikumpulkan semata-mata sebagai bagian dari persiapan artikel ini.

Karena fakta bahwa saya menyentuh sistem untuk waktu yang lama, dan tidak menyentuh beberapa di antaranya sama sekali, saya tidak memiliki tangkapan layar atau contoh apa pun. Jadi saya menyegarkan kembali pengetahuan saya di Google, wiki, di youtube, situs pengembang, saya menggali tangkapan layar di sana, dan sebagai hasilnya saya mendapat gambaran seperti itu.

1. Teori

1.1. Mengapa?

Untuk menjawab pertanyaan "Mengapa?" Pertama, Anda perlu memahami apa itu "Peta Jaringan". Peta jaringan - (paling sering) representasi logis-grafis-skema dari interaksi perangkat jaringan dan koneksinya, yang menggambarkan parameter dan properti paling signifikan. Saat ini, sering digunakan bersamaan dengan memantau status perangkat dan sistem peringatan. Jadi: kemudian, untuk mendapatkan gambaran tentang lokasi node jaringan, interaksinya, dan koneksi di antara mereka. Sehubungan dengan pemantauan, kami mendapatkan alat kerja untuk mendiagnosis perilaku dan memprediksi perilaku jaringan.

1.2. L1, L2, L3

Mereka juga Layer 1, Layer 2 dan Layer 3 sesuai dengan model OSI. L1 - level fisik (kabel dan switching), L2 - level pengalamatan fisik (alamat mac), L3 - level pengalamatan logis (alamat IP).

Nyatanya, tidak ada gunanya membangun peta L1, secara logis mengikuti dari L2 yang sama, dengan pengecualian, mungkin, konverter media. Lalu, sekarang ada konverter media yang juga bisa dilacak.

Logikanya - L2 membangun peta jaringan berdasarkan alamat mac dari node, L3 - pada alamat IP dari node.

1.3. Data apa yang akan ditampilkan

Itu tergantung pada tugas yang harus diselesaikan dan keinginan. Misalnya, saya tentu saja ingin memahami apakah potongan besi itu sendiri "hidup", di port mana ia "menggantung" dan dalam keadaan apa port itu naik atau turun. Mungkin L2. Dan secara umum, L2 menurut saya topologi peta jaringan yang paling dapat diterapkan dalam arti terapan. Tapi, rasa dan warnanya ...

Kecepatan koneksi di port tidak buruk, tetapi tidak kritis jika ada perangkat akhir di sana - printer PC. Alangkah baiknya bisa melihat tingkat beban prosesor, jumlah RAM yang kosong, dan suhu pada sepotong besi. Tapi ini tidak mudah lagi, di sini Anda perlu mengonfigurasi sistem pemantauan yang dapat membaca SNMP dan menampilkan serta menganalisis data yang diterima. Lebih lanjut tentang ini nanti.

Mengenai L3, saya menemukan yang ini sebuah artikel.

1.4. Bagaimana?

Bisa dilakukan secara manual, bisa dilakukan secara otomatis. Jika dengan tangan, maka untuk waktu yang lama dan faktor manusia perlu diperhitungkan. Jika otomatis, maka Anda perlu memperhitungkan bahwa semua perangkat jaringan harus "pintar", dapat menggunakan SNMP, dan SNMP ini harus dikonfigurasi dengan benar agar sistem yang akan mengumpulkan data darinya dapat membaca data ini.

Sepertinya tidak sulit. Tapi ada jebakan. Dimulai dengan fakta bahwa tidak setiap sistem dapat membaca semua data yang ingin kita lihat dari perangkat, atau tidak semua perangkat jaringan dapat memberikan data ini, dan diakhiri dengan fakta bahwa tidak setiap sistem dapat membuat peta jaringan di mode otomatis.

Proses pembuatan peta otomatis kira-kira sebagai berikut:

– sistem membaca data dari peralatan jaringan
- berdasarkan data, ini membentuk tabel pencocokan alamat pada port untuk setiap port router
- cocok dengan alamat dan nama perangkat
- membangun koneksi port-portdevice
- menggambar semua ini dalam bentuk diagram, "intuitif" bagi pengguna

2. Latihan

Jadi, sekarang mari kita bicara tentang apa yang dapat Anda gunakan untuk membuat peta jaringan. Mari kita ambil sebagai titik awal yang kita inginkan, tentu saja, untuk mengotomatiskan proses ini sebanyak mungkin. Artinya, Paint dan MS Visio tidak lagi... meskipun... Tidak, mereka sudah.

Ada perangkat lunak khusus yang memecahkan masalah membangun peta jaringan. Beberapa produk perangkat lunak hanya dapat menyediakan lingkungan untuk menambahkan gambar dengan properti "secara manual", menggambar tautan, dan meluncurkan "pemantauan" dalam bentuk yang sangat terpotong (apakah node hidup atau tidak merespons lagi). Orang lain tidak hanya dapat menggambar diagram jaringan sendiri, tetapi juga membaca banyak parameter dari SNMP, memberi tahu pengguna melalui SMS jika terjadi kerusakan, memberikan banyak informasi tentang port perangkat keras jaringan, dan semua ini hanya bagian dari fungsinya (NetXMS yang sama).

2.1. Produk

Daftarnya jauh dari lengkap, karena ada banyak perangkat lunak semacam itu. Tapi ini semua yang diberikan Google tentang topik tersebut (termasuk situs berbahasa Inggris):

Proyek sumber terbuka:
LanTopoLog
nagios
Icinga
NeDi
Pandora FM
PRTG
NetXMS
Zabbix

Proyek berbayar:
Negara Bagian Lan
Monitor Jaringan Total
Pemeta Topologi Jaringan Solarwinds
penjelajah UV
auvik
AdRem NetCrunch

2.2.1. Perangkat lunak gratis

2.2.1.1. LanTopoLog

Situs web

peta jaringan. Gambaran singkat perangkat lunak untuk membangun peta jaringan

Perangkat lunak yang dikembangkan oleh Yuri Volokitin. Antarmukanya sesederhana mungkin. Softina mendukung, katakanlah, pembangunan jaringan semi-otomatis. Dia perlu "memberi makan" pengaturan semua router (IP, kredensial SNMP), maka semuanya akan terjadi dengan sendirinya, yaitu koneksi antar perangkat akan dibangun dengan port penunjuk.

Ada versi produk berbayar dan gratis.

Panduan video

2.2.1.2. Nagios

Situs web

peta jaringan. Gambaran singkat perangkat lunak untuk membangun peta jaringan

peta jaringan. Gambaran singkat perangkat lunak untuk membangun peta jaringan

Perangkat lunak Open Source telah ada sejak tahun 1999. Sistem ini dirancang untuk pemantauan jaringan, yaitu dapat membaca data melalui SNMP dan secara otomatis membangun peta jaringan, tetapi karena ini bukan fungsi utamanya, ini dilakukan dengan cara yang sangat ... aneh ... NagVis digunakan untuk membangun peta.

Panduan video

2.2.1.3. lapisan es

Situs web

peta jaringan. Gambaran singkat perangkat lunak untuk membangun peta jaringan

peta jaringan. Gambaran singkat perangkat lunak untuk membangun peta jaringan

Icinga adalah sistem Open Source yang pernah dipisahkan dari Nagios. Sistem ini memungkinkan Anda membuat peta jaringan secara otomatis. Satu-satunya masalah adalah membangun peta menggunakan addon NagVis, yang dikembangkan di bawah Nagios, jadi kami akan menganggap bahwa kedua sistem ini identik dalam hal membangun peta jaringan.

Panduan video

2.2.1.4. NeDi

Situs web

peta jaringan. Gambaran singkat perangkat lunak untuk membangun peta jaringan

Mampu mendeteksi node dalam jaringan secara otomatis, dan berdasarkan data ini, membangun peta jaringan. Antarmukanya cukup sederhana, ada pemantauan status melalui SNMP.

Ada versi produk gratis dan berbayar.

Panduan video

2.2.1.5. Pandora FM

Situs web

peta jaringan. Gambaran singkat perangkat lunak untuk membangun peta jaringan

Mampu dalam penemuan otomatis, membangun jaringan secara otomatis, SNMP. Antarmuka yang bagus.

Ada versi produk gratis dan berbayar.

Panduan video

2.2.1.6. PRTG

Situs web

peta jaringan. Gambaran singkat perangkat lunak untuk membangun peta jaringan

Perangkat lunak tidak mengetahui cara membuat peta jaringan secara otomatis, hanya menyeret dan melepaskan gambar secara manual. Tetapi pada saat yang sama, dapat memantau status perangkat melalui SNMP. Antarmuka meninggalkan banyak hal yang diinginkan, menurut pendapat subjektif saya.

30 hari - fungsionalitas penuh, lalu - "versi gratis".

Panduan video

2.2.1.7. NetXMS

Situs web

peta jaringan. Gambaran singkat perangkat lunak untuk membangun peta jaringan

NetMXS pada dasarnya adalah sistem pemantauan Open Source, membangun peta jaringan adalah fungsi sampingan. Namun penerapannya cukup rapi. Pembuatan otomatis berdasarkan penemuan otomatis, pemantauan simpul melalui SNMP, dapat melacak status port router dan statistik lainnya.

Panduan video

2.2.1.8. Zabbix

Situs web

peta jaringan. Gambaran singkat perangkat lunak untuk membangun peta jaringan

Zabbix juga merupakan sistem pemantauan Sumber Terbuka, lebih fleksibel dan kuat daripada NetXMS, tetapi hanya dapat membuat peta jaringan dalam mode manual, tetapi dapat memantau hampir semua parameter router, yang kumpulannya hanya dapat dikonfigurasi.

Panduan video

2.2.2. Perangkat lunak berbayar

2.2.2..1 Status Lan

Situs web

peta jaringan. Gambaran singkat perangkat lunak untuk membangun peta jaringan

Perangkat lunak berbayar yang memungkinkan Anda memindai topologi jaringan secara otomatis dan membuat peta jaringan berdasarkan peralatan yang terdeteksi. Memungkinkan Anda memantau status perangkat yang terdeteksi hanya dengan menaikkan node itu sendiri.

Panduan video

2.2.2.2. Monitor Jaringan Total

Situs web

peta jaringan. Gambaran singkat perangkat lunak untuk membangun peta jaringan

Perangkat lunak berbayar yang tidak secara otomatis membuat peta jaringan. Bahkan tidak tahu cara mendeteksi node secara otomatis. Sebenarnya, ini adalah Visio yang sama, hanya fokus pada topologi jaringan. Memungkinkan Anda memantau status perangkat yang terdeteksi hanya dengan menaikkan node itu sendiri.

Omong kosong! Saya tulis di atas bahwa kami menolak Paint dan Visio ... Oke, biarlah.

Saya tidak menemukan manual video, dan saya tidak membutuhkannya ... Programnya biasa saja.

2.2.2.3. Pemeta Topologi Jaringan Solarwinds

Situs web

peta jaringan. Gambaran singkat perangkat lunak untuk membangun peta jaringan

Software berbayar, ada masa trial. Itu dapat secara otomatis memindai jaringan dan membuat peta sendiri sesuai dengan parameter yang ditentukan. Antarmukanya cukup sederhana dan menyenangkan.

Panduan video

2.2.2.4. penjelajah UV

Situs web

peta jaringan. Gambaran singkat perangkat lunak untuk membangun peta jaringan

Perangkat lunak berbayar, uji coba 15 hari. Itu dapat mendeteksi secara otomatis dan menggambar peta secara otomatis, memantau perangkat hanya dengan keadaan naik / turun, yaitu melalui ping perangkat.

Panduan video

2.2.2.5. Auvic

Situs web

peta jaringan. Gambaran singkat perangkat lunak untuk membangun peta jaringan

Program berbayar yang cukup bagus yang dapat mendeteksi dan memantau perangkat jaringan secara otomatis.

Panduan video

2.2.2.6. AdRem NetCrunch

Situs web

peta jaringan. Gambaran singkat perangkat lunak untuk membangun peta jaringan

Perangkat lunak berbayar dengan uji coba 14 hari. Mampu mendeteksi otomatis dan membangun jaringan secara otomatis. Antarmukanya tidak menimbulkan antusiasme. Bisa juga memantau di SNMP.

Panduan video

3. Plat perbandingan

Ternyata, cukup sulit untuk menghasilkan parameter yang relevan dan penting untuk membandingkan sistem dan pada saat yang sama memasukkannya ke dalam satu piring kecil. Inilah yang saya dapatkan:

peta jaringan. Gambaran singkat perangkat lunak untuk membangun peta jaringan

*Pengaturan "Ramah Pengguna" sangat subyektif dan saya memahaminya. Tapi bagaimana lagi menggambarkan "kecanggungan dan ketidakterbacaan" yang tidak saya pikirkan.

**"Memantau tidak hanya jaringan" menyiratkan pengoperasian sistem sebagai "sistem pemantauan" dalam arti biasa istilah ini, yaitu, kemampuan membaca metrik dari OS, host virtualisasi, menerima data dari aplikasi di tamu OS, dll.

4. Pendapat pribadi

Dari pengalaman pribadi, saya tidak melihat pentingnya menggunakan perangkat lunak secara terpisah untuk pemantauan jaringan. Saya lebih terkesan dengan gagasan menggunakan sistem pemantauan untuk segala hal dan semua orang dengan kemampuan membangun peta jaringan. Zabbix mengalami kesulitan dengan ini. Nagios dan Icinga juga. Dan hanya NetXSM yang senang dalam hal ini. Meskipun, jika Anda bingung dan membuat peta di Zabbix, tampilannya bahkan lebih menjanjikan daripada NetXMS. Ada juga Pandora FMS, PRTG, Solarwinds NTM, AdRem NetCrunch, dan kemungkinan besar banyak hal lain yang tidak termasuk dalam artikel ini, tetapi saya hanya melihatnya di gambar dan video, jadi saya tidak bisa mengatakan apa-apa tentangnya.

Tentang NetXMS ditulis artikel dengan ikhtisar kecil tentang kemampuan sistem dan sedikit cara.

PS:

Jika saya melakukan kesalahan di suatu tempat, dan kemungkinan besar saya melakukan kesalahan, tolong perbaiki di komentar, saya akan memperbaiki artikel sehingga mereka yang menganggap informasi ini berguna tidak perlu memeriksa ulang semuanya dari pengalaman mereka sendiri.

Terima kasih.

Sumber: www.habr.com

Tambah komentar